How much do beer distributing j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 4, 2026, the average hourly pay for beer distributing in the United States is $18.93,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.07 and $19.23 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What do beer distributors do?

Beer distributors are companies or individuals responsible for purchasing beer from breweries and delivering it to retailers, such as bars, restaurants, and stores. They play a crucial role in the supply chain by ensuring that beer is stored, transported, and delivered safely and legally according to state and federal regulations. Distributors also help breweries expand their market reach, manage inventory, and sometimes assist with marketing and promotional activities to boost sales.

What is the difference between Beer Distributing vs Beer Sales Representative?

AspectBeer DistributingBeer Sales Representative
CredentialsDriver's license, possibly distribution or commercial driving certificationsSales certifications, industry knowledge
Work EnvironmentWarehouse, delivery routes, distribution centersOffices, client meetings, retail locations
Employer & Industry UsageDistributors, wholesale companies, breweriesBreweries, beverage companies, retail outlets

Beer Distributing involves the physical delivery of beer products to retailers or venues, focusing on logistics and transportation. In contrast, a Beer Sales Representative primarily promotes and sells beer to clients, building relationships and increasing sales. While both roles require industry knowledge, Beer Distributing emphasizes driving and logistics, whereas Beer Sales Representatives focus on sales and customer interaction.
